HUD 202 Senior Housing Communities - Catholic Charities Diocese of St. Petersburg

This agency helps older adults find a place to live. They have several apartment communities for people who are 62 or older. Each community has someone called a Service Coordinator who can help you get services like food stamps. There are also fun activities planned for people who live there.

Pasco County's Down Payment Assistance Program

This program helps people buy their own homes. There are funds available to help you with your down payment. You must make less than 120% of the median income in the Tampa Bay area to qualify.
You do not have to be a first time home buyer. You do not have to be a current Pasco County resident. You must attend a County Homebuyer class.

Any kind of home is eligible, except for mobile or manufactured homes.

You will need to put some of your own money into the purchase of the house. This can be in the form of down payment, closing costs or other pre-paid items.

This is a 0% interest loan.

PCCDD - Owner Occupied Rehab

This program is to help homeowners pay for repairs to their houses. Any type of home is eligible, except for mobile homes. Properties may be anywhere within the County. The maximum after-rehab value of the property cannot exceed $240,000.

Anyone who makes less than 120% of the median income for the Tampa Bay area may apply. You must show that you have at least 10% of the required cost of repairs. The County loan cannot exceed $10,000. This is a 0% interest loan which you will have five years to pay off.
